Output 24c8530eae609722385c57bbdc4f5a5d5fe2d7cefab228f7f57d77e9d180c263:1

value
344274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f00b5ed8bfc2494bfeff6bfae8351bfabf333d OP_EQUAL
address
3JBj7ekPy7qpLQjfJ8jwqVZGTZag4iaGaM
transaction
24c8530eae609722385c57bbdc4f5a5d5fe2d7cefab228f7f57d77e9d180c263
confirmations
340610
spent
true